Kuwait City (KWI) to Mehamn (MEH) Flight Distance

The flight distance from Kuwait International Airport (KWI) in Kuwait City, Kuwait to Mehamn Airport (MEH) in Mehamn, Norway is 4,812 kilometers (2,990 miles / 2,598 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 7h, flying north at a heading of 351°.

This is a long-haul route typically operated by wide-body aircraft such as the Boeing 777 or Airbus A350. Full meal service, in-flight entertainment, and comfort amenities are standard.

This is an international route connecting Kuwait with Norway. It is an intercontinental flight between Asia and Europe. Travelers should check visa requirements, customs regulations, and any travel advisories before booking.

Time zone information: When it's 11:48 in Kuwait City, it's 09:48 in Mehamn.

The return flight from Mehamn (MEH) to Kuwait City (KWI) follows a heading of 154° (south southeast). Actual flight times may vary depending on wind conditions, air traffic, and the specific aircraft used.
